Eckhart Tolle is widely considered one of our generation’s most important intellectuals. “The Power of Now,” Tolle’s earlier book, was once a best seller before “A New Earth.” “A New Earth” made up to this list for one simple reason: it teaches readers how to change their pain into peace rather than simply living in the moment. From rage and grief to envy and anxiety, the book covers a wide range of emotions.
Fear gets the best of us far too frequently. In her New York Times best book “You Are a Badass,” Jen Sincero helps people overcome their fears. The entertaining end-of-chapter exercises distinguish this self-help book from others. Instead of tossing the book aside and letting it gather dust once you’ve finished reading the last page, you’ll be motivated to go back and reflect on the prior activities you completed. The tasks also reinforce the arguments made by Sincero in her text. Going back to your entries will put a positive spin on your day and remind you why you should show yourself more self-love when you’re feeling low on confidence.
Stephen Covey’s “The 7 Habits of Highly Effective People” is a book that many people have read or heard about. Sean Covey, Covey’s son, followed in his father’s footsteps, creating a teen version that uses the same ideas to help youngsters master crucial aspects of their lives. Covey breaks up the text with cartoons, quips, brainstorming ideas, and experiences from real teens to make this self-help book age-appropriate and downright fun to read.
